?? Ethernet Crossover or Patch Cable
 
Hello

I have a Desktop pc and a Laptop pc.

I also have ntl Broadband Cable 2mg, connected by Ethernet connection.

I sometimes like to connect my laptop to the internet, usually but not often enough, for wireless connection, I am somewhat confused by whether I should need a crosover or patch Ethernet cable.
I would really appreciate advice.

Thanks for any advice/help

Church Mouse.

Wicked_and_Crazy 25-01-2007 00:46

Re: ?? Ethernet Crossover or Patch Cable
 
use the same cable that is in your desktop?

its a patch cable, you only need a cross over if you were connecting the laptop direct to the destop pc to share the modem

zing_deleted 25-01-2007 01:14

Re: ?? Ethernet Crossover or Patch Cable
 
Do you only want to use one machine at a time? if your just going to swap leads and use the modem individually you need a straight patch cable if you want to link the laptop and computer and set up internet sharing you need crossover

zing_deleted 25-01-2007 01:33

Re: ?? Ethernet Crossover or Patch Cable
 
you just run network connection wizard and click the settings of ICS .Yes it is a single cable

detailed instructions for manual set up here http://www.annoyances.org/exec/show/ics_xp

Problem is if you only have 1 ethernet port on the tower you will have to connect the modem to USB
